Over 20 doctors of science to work on examination of Soviet Latvia's KGB documents

BC, Riga, 15.09.2015.Print version
The research commission set up to examine Soviet Latvia's KGB documents will include more than twenty doctors of sciences – respected historians, sociologists, literary scientists, philosophers, lawyers, and others, informs LETA.

These are Doctor of History Karlis Kangeris, Doctor of Law Kristine Jarinovska, Doctor of History Ainars Bambals, Doctor of History Raimonds Ceruzis, Doctor of Communication Science Martins Kaprans, Institute of Philosophy and Sociology researcher Solveiga Krumina-Konkova, Doctor of History Janis Keruss, Doctor of History Janis Taurens.

 

The commission's experts will include Doctor of Literature Eva Eglaja-Krostsone, Doctor of Law Elina Grigore-Bara, Doctor of History Gints Zelmenis, Doctor of History Ritvars Jansons, and others.
